- Mountain Gateway Community College is a public, open access institution of higher education in the Virginia Community College System.
MGCCis centrally located in Clifton Forge, VA and operates a regional campus in Buena Vista, VA.MGCCserves the counties of Alleghany, Bath, Rockbridge and Botetourt (northern half).Adjunct faculty members are responsible for effectively planning and teaching courses in a classroom environment to students with a variety of academic backgrounds and experiences. We are currently seeking adjuncts in the field of Philosophy at the Clifton Forge Campus to teach on ground.
